Many cities promise a great lifestyle. However, Manhattan consistently delivers a combination of affordability, opportunity, and community spirit.
First, the city provides a strong local economy anchored by education, healthcare, and research institutions. Kansas State University remains the largest employer in the region. Additionally, Fort Riley military base nearby supports thousands of jobs.
Because of these institutions, Manhattan attracts professionals from many industries. Meanwhile, entrepreneurs also discover opportunities within the city’s growing business environment.
Second, the natural surroundings make Manhattan visually stunning. The Flint Hills prairie creates scenic views and outdoor recreation opportunities. Hiking, cycling, and wildlife watching remain popular activities.
Finally, Manhattan maintains a welcoming atmosphere. Neighbors greet one another. Local businesses support community events. Therefore, many residents quickly feel at home.
The housing market in Manhattan reflects both stability and steady growth. Because of the university and nearby military base, housing demand remains consistent throughout the year.
Homes range widely in style and price. Buyers can find starter homes, luxury houses, townhomes, and investment properties across the city.
Many properties feature spacious yards, modern upgrades, and quiet residential streets. Meanwhile, some historic homes showcase classic Midwestern architecture.
Prices vary depending on location and property size. However, Manhattan generally offers more affordable housing compared with larger metropolitan areas.
Additionally, the market attracts investors seeking rental properties. College students often rent homes near campus. Consequently, some buyers purchase properties specifically for rental income.

Another exciting housing option lies near Aggieville, the entertainment district next to Kansas State University.
This area attracts students, professors, and young professionals. Because of its proximity to campus, homes here often serve as rental properties.
However, some families also enjoy living in the neighborhood. The lively atmosphere offers convenient access to restaurants, coffee shops, and nightlife.
Buyers will find:
Townhomes and duplexes
Smaller single-family houses
Investment properties for student rentals
Because demand remains strong, properties near Aggieville often sell quickly.

Buyers seeking upscale real estate often explore the Grand Mere neighborhood. Located along the western edge of Manhattan, this community offers breathtaking views of the Flint Hills.
Luxury homes here often feature impressive architectural designs. Large windows highlight prairie sunsets and scenic landscapes.
Many properties include:
Gourmet kitchens
Spacious outdoor patios
Custom landscaping
Three-car garages
Furthermore, the neighborhood surrounds the beautiful Colbert Hills Golf Course in Manhattan Kansas.
Golf enthusiasts especially enjoy living nearby. The peaceful setting also appeals to professionals and retirees seeking quiet luxury.

Because Kansas State University enrolls thousands of students, Manhattan presents strong rental opportunities.
Many investors purchase homes near campus. Students often share houses or duplexes during the school year.
Additionally, military families from Fort Riley frequently rent homes while stationed nearby.
Investment buyers often search for:
Multi-unit duplex properties
Student rental houses
Townhomes near campus
Because demand remains steady, rental properties often produce consistent income.

Another reason buyers seek homes for sale in Manhattan Kansas involves education and career opportunities.
Kansas State University provides world-class academic programs. The campus also hosts research facilities and innovation centers.
Meanwhile, healthcare organizations, research labs, and agricultural businesses contribute to the local economy.
The National Bio and Agro-Defense Facility in Manhattan Kansas recently opened nearby. This major research center strengthens the region’s scientific reputation.
